I work with many high-achieving, hardworking individuals who often define their identity, worth, and sense of meaning through productivity, performance, and external success. While these strengths can lead to accomplishment and reliability, they can also create pressure, burnout, and a persistent sense of never feeling “enough,” no matter how much is achieved. Perfectionism often shows up as self-criticism, difficulty resting, fear of failure, people-pleasing, or feeling anxious even during moments of success. Many clients come to me feeling exhausted by their own standards, yet unsure how to slow down or step away from the patterns that have helped them succeed. In our work together, we explore the deeper roots of perfectionism- often shaped by past experiences, family expectations, or learned beliefs about worth and achievement. At the same time, we focus on practical ways to challenge rigid thinking patterns, reduce anxiety, and develop a more balanced and compassionate relationship with oneself. My goal is to help clients begin to separate their identity from their productivity, reconnect with what actually matters to them, and build a life that feels not only successful on the outside, but also grounded, sustainable, and meaningful on the inside.

Harlem is the historic capital of Black American culture, a Manhattan neighborhood whose churches, music, and institutions shaped a century of American life, now navigating intense gentrification alongside enduring community strength. Mental health needs include racial stress and historical trauma, economic displacement pressure, and a legacy of historically rooted caution toward medical institutions — met by strong community organizations and a growing cohort of Black therapists in the city. Harlem Hospital, community health networks, and NYC's broad market provide care.

Perfectionism therapists in Harlem, NY Statistics

Perfectionism therapists in Harlem, NY average 12 years of experience and charge around $217 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(69%), Psychodynamic Therapy (48%), and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) (40%).
